When to Use Steel vs Wood for a Building Project

The choice between steel and wood depends on various factors. This can include everything from the specific application, what the budget range is, any environmental concerns, and aesthetic preferences.

That being said, steel is often best for…

When Strength and Durability is Essential

Overall, steel is significantly stronger and more durable than wood. It’s often the preferred choice for structural applications when it comes to high-rises, bridges, and industrial buildings.

Large-Scale Construction Projects

When it comes to the support of large-scale construction projects, steel is the material used to manage this.
